Transaction 76a5a51b36ae672442f3aba8c65b72a856e8a4ba80c7434e6ed9f6d460888e00

11 Input
2 Outputs
  • 76a5a51b36ae672442f3aba8c65b72a856e8a4ba80c7434e6ed9f6d460888e00:0
  • value  108591603
    address  1nhjZb1aQo5WAUYm5tVNjEhuvgE1j9isL
  • 76a5a51b36ae672442f3aba8c65b72a856e8a4ba80c7434e6ed9f6d460888e00:1
  • value  416968
    address  3Kiwtq7StqxBPZpvDm6NyQ2wVwjBLjXMGD